The below graph shows the average detached house price in the Wealden local authority area over time, sourced from the HPI. The four 1 DEEPDENE sales between April 2000 and July 2018 have been plotted on the graph. A line has been extrapolated to show what the value of the property might have been over time, following each sale, had it maintained the same margin above or below the HPI (as a percentage). For example, the July 2014 sale was for 6% below the HPI. So the extrapolation line tracks at 6% below the HPI over time, until the July 2018 sale, where it rises to 7% above the HPI. The line then continues to track at 7% above the HPI.
